About Trinity International School

Trinity International School is a private high school in Las Vegas, NV, serving approximately 51 students in grades 6th-12th with a 8:1 student-teacher ratio.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 8.0 out of 10 and ranks #4 of 77 private schools in NV.

Is Trinity International School a private school?

Yes, Trinity International School is a private coeducational school with a Christian, no specific denomination affiliation. Private schools are not required to participate in state standardized testing, so academic performance data may be limited compared to public schools.
